HOW ARE YOU USING YOUR KNIGHT’S EXPERIENCE MONEY: I used the Knight’s Experience Fund to help me complete my student-teaching in the Waverly-Shell Rock School District. I had the great opportunity to collaborate with master educators in the music department to improve my teaching skills. I led rehearsals, guided students through private voice lessons, reflected on my teaching skills with my collaborating teachers, and formed impacting relationships with the students and educators within the Waverly-Shell Rock community.
HOW DID THIS EXPERIENCE PREPARE YOU FOR SUCCESS: This experience prepares me for what to expect in my classroom. Like in any profession, it is important to have mentors guiding us through the do’s and don’ts of working in the real world. I’m learning how to run effective rehearsals in various grade levels, understand the administrative side of being an educator, and build endurance when balancing my school life and personal life.
HOW DID THE KNIGHT’S EXPERIENCE HELP YOU WITH YOUR STUDENT-TEACHING: This fund helped me prepare for success in the classroom and to obtain resources for professional development. I want to take any opportunity to be well-prepared when in the field.
ANYTHING ELSE YOU WOULD LIKE TO ADD: This fund and this experience allowed me to acquire hands-on learning in being a music educator. I learned more about myself in those 11 weeks than I did in my four years of being a student. I’m thankful for this experience and what I’ve been able to learn from my peers, mentors, and students.
